I decided to email Tandy about their white rouge, they sent me a copy of the MSDS and this is what it said
SECTION 1. IDENTIFICATION OF THE SUBSTANCE/PREPARATION AND COMPANY
PRODUCT IDENTITY:
WHITE ROUGE
COMPANY IDENTITY: THUNDERBIRD SUPPLY CORP
SECTION 2. COMPOSITION/INFORMATION ON INGREDIENTS
85-95% ALUMINUM OXIDE
I made a call to Thunderbird and asked about the grit size, (they first had to call someone else) , they told me the best that they could find out was that it is some where between 1 and 5 microns. Must be what they call quality control
Looking on the web I found this Grit to Micron chart that says it could be between 4500 and 14000 grit.
